About PCP Summary

Established in 1971, Pacific Coast Producers is a cooperative owned by over 165 family farmers that grow and deliver various produce, including tomatoes, peaches, pears, grapes, cherries, and more, to production facilities in California and Oregon for processing and packaging. With over 3,000 dedicated employees, PCP strives to produce the finest quality products for customers across all channels of trade, including grocery retailers and foodservice distributors throughout the United States and Canada.
